Open-house speaker says Pacific Clinics mobile response team helped 176 people since March
Summary
A commenter at the meeting described an open house for Pacific Clinics and San Bernardino Health and said the local mobile response team began services March 20, 2025, and has assisted 176 people; several details, including units for response time and the area where staff live, were not specified in the transcript.

Speaker 1, a commenter, said Pacific Clinics and San Bernardino Health held an open house and began providing local services on March 20, 2025. Speaker 1 said the clinics’ mobile or bulk response team has “responded, helped a 176 individuals,” and reported an “average is time 17.”
The speaker said more than half of clinic staff live locally but did not specify the exact geography referenced. The commenter described the open house as “very nice” and thanked staff for their work in the community.
The remarks were presented as a public comment and not introduced as an agenda item; no formal action was recorded in the transcript. Several numeric details in the speaker’s remarks—most notably the unit for the reported “average is time 17” and the precise area referenced for staff residence—were not specified in the transcript text provided.
